Looks like it's just an access hatch. You can see the outline of it in the old photo. I'm thinking those two "O" rings at the edge are either hook points for the ladder, or are twist releases for the panel so that you can open the panel with a pole from below.

And the two other things not mentioned from the "new" photo, the lifthill railing were extended taller, the there are (apparently) new nightvision cameras mounted on the new railings, pointing down the hill at the riders coming up the hill. (They appear to be a camera with their own self-contained infrared light source, rather than the old cameras that needed an external infrared "floodlight") And if you look waaaaayyyyy up at the top of Alpha's lift, it looks like another one.
